‘Fascinable’, eight stories about life and art

Eight narratives make up ‘Fascinable’, the work of Yurre Ugarte published by Alberdania publishing house and presented in San Sebastián. Each one explains very different situations, but as the author herself recognizes, all are wrapped in the same atmosphere, in an environment marked by art. “They are characters wounded by art, because that art, for them, is a way of life, since they find in fascination the way to conjure up everyday life.”

The last of the eight stories is a literary-musical legend which is not strictly fiction, “despite the risks involved. In pure fiction narratives, the characters live in very different situations: in one of them, a journalist must face the fact of telling her daughter who her father is; in another, a photographer will recall the influence that a friend from adolescence had on her, and will transport the experiences shared in the past to the present; an artist recycled into a cultural manager will take the floor to narrate his adventures, and so will a designer who has now become homeless. Or the doctoral student who is about to defend her thesis on pop art … »

Yurre Ugarte has presented his ‘Fascinable’ together with the editor of Alberdania Jorge Giménez Bech who has summarized his opinion on the essential characteristics of the author. «A fundamental feature of Yurre Ugarte’s literature is its narrative rigor. I could cite his skill in handling the characters staged, also mention the efficiency with which he solves dialogues, or his ability in portraying atmospheres, times and contexts … But I’ll stick with what I have called narrative rigor ».

During the presentation, Giménez Bech has come to resort to the term “magic.” «Yurre Ugarte does not choose especially unusual, suggestive or surprising topics or events, but she displays a powerful magic when it comes to weaving unusual, suggestive and surprising stories: she offers us a kind of magical everyday life or, if you prefer, magic of the everyday , always with extreme rigor ».

Yurre Ugarte works since 1991 in teleseries. She is the author of short films, theatrical texts, comics and works of children’s and youth literature. He has published the short story book ‘Todo es rojo’ and the graphic novel ‘Joana Maiz’.
